Here's the explanation for this....

Those white streaks planes leave behind are actually artificial clouds. They're called contrails, which is a shortened version of the phrase “condensation trail."Airplane engines produce exhaust, just like car engines do. As hot exhaust gases escape from a plane, the water vapor in the fumes hits the air. At heights of 26,000 feet or more, the air is extremely cold. The cold air causes the water vapor to condense. This means the water vapor turns into tiny water droplets or even freeze into tiny ice crystals before eventually evaporating. This condensed water vapor and mixture of ice crystals make up the cloud-like trails you see in the sky.
